About Accountants in Russellville, MO

Finding a qualified accountant in Russellville, Missouri, can make a significant difference for both local businesses and individuals. Russellville’s economy is rooted in agriculture, small retail, and service businesses, meaning many residents deal with farm income, self-employment taxes, or seasonal cash flow. An experienced accountant familiar with these rural financial patterns can help you navigate deductions, estimated tax payments, and record-keeping specific to your situation.

Beyond tax preparation, a local accountant offers year-round support. Whether you’re buying a home, starting a side business, or planning for retirement, having a professional who understands Missouri state tax rules and local economic conditions provides peace of mind. They can also assist with IRS notices, bookkeeping, and financial planning.

Frequently Asked Questions

What services does an accountant provide?

Accountants typically offer bookkeeping, financial statement preparation, tax planning and preparation, payroll services, accounts payable and receivable management, and general financial consulting for both individuals and businesses.

How do I choose the right accountant?

Look for an accountant with experience in your industry or tax situation, check their credentials and references, ask about their availability during tax season, and make sure they use modern accounting software. A good accountant should be proactive about finding deductions and keeping you compliant.

What is the difference between an accountant and a bookkeeper?

A bookkeeper records daily financial transactions, while an accountant analyzes financial data, prepares tax returns, and provides strategic financial advice. Many accounting firms offer both services, with bookkeepers handling the day-to-day work and accountants overseeing the bigger financial picture.
